Output 2506799106d3067e122d72857447870f75a472a87371b45bc9ced993b71cb125:4

value
99550130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8117ed123db808765453fa78d2c2bf7f7829bd77 OP_EQUAL
address
MKfk4b4YPzF33YVxJBPm18fxiAHdgXsC6P
transaction
2506799106d3067e122d72857447870f75a472a87371b45bc9ced993b71cb125
spent
true